Afterwards, visit the income percentile by state and income percentile by city calculator.Sep 12, 2023 · Real median household income was $74,580 in 2022, a 2.3 percent decline from the 2021 estimate of $76,330 (Figure 1 and Table A-1). Householders under the age of 65 experienced a decline in median household income of 1.4 percent from 2021, while householders aged 65 and over did not experience a significant change in median income between 2021 and 2022 (Figure 1).

Oct 30, 2023 · At the time of writing, a £70k annual salary would put you in the 91st percentile (top 9% of earners) in the UK. Check the calculator for more precise figures for your age group, region, and industry sector. The median salary of 45- to 54-year-olds is $1,272 per week or $66,144 per year. That’s only slightly more than the median for 35- to 44-year-olds, though the weekly median for men aged 45 to 54 years is $1,404. Again, the gender income gap is significant in this age group. The inflation-adjusted …How to Calculate Percentile. Arrange n number of data points in ascending order: x 1, x 2, x 3, ... x n. Calculate the rank r for the percentile p you want to find: r = (p/100) * (n - 1) + 1. If r is an integer then the data value at location r, x r, is the percentile p: p = x r.
